2013-10-31 130 views
0

我必须在php中显示数字。我在数据库中取数据类型为float。我的问题是,当数字不是整数时,它将正常工作,例如,如果数字是4.22,那么它很好。但如果数字是4,则显示4.00。但我想只显示它4. 请告诉我该怎么做。显示整数和整数浮点数作为浮点数

的正是我想要

4.33 => 4.33 
4.00 => 4 

回答

5

使用floatval()实现这一目标。

例如

var_dump(floatval(4.33)); 
var_dump(floatval(4.00)); 

输出:

float 4.33 

float 4 
+0

thanks Latheesan Kanes –

1

你在找什么是floatval()

echo floatval(4.00); 
4 

echo floatval(4.33); 
4.33 
+0

thanks silkfire –